Boundary value problem for system of pseudo-hyperbolic equations of the fourth order with nonlocal condition

Abstract: We consider a boundary value problem for system of pseudo-hyperbolic equations of the fourth order with nonlocal condition on rectangular domain. By introducing new unknown function considered problem is reduced to equivalent nonlocal problem with integral condition for system of hyperbolic integro-differential equations of the second order. Algorithm for finding of approximate solution to equivalent problem is proposed and its convergence is proved on the basis method of functional parametrization. Sufficient conditions of the existence unique classical solution to boundary value problem for system of pseudo-hyperbolic equations of the fourth order with nonlocal condition are established in the terms of initial data.

Keywords: system of pseudo-hyperbolic equations, nonlocal problem, system of hyperbolic integro-differential equations, integral condition, solvability.
